A Week's Meditations is a religious book written by J. Hatchard and Son in 1823. The book is intended to guide readers in their spiritual journey after receiving the Holy Sacrament of the Lord's Supper. It contains a series of meditations that are meant to be read over the course of a week, with each day focusing on a different aspect of the reader's faith. The meditations cover a range of topics, including repentance, forgiveness, gratitude, and humility, and are designed to help readers reflect on their relationship with God and deepen their understanding of their faith. The book is written in a clear and accessible style, making it suitable for readers of all ages and backgrounds.
